Mirtazapine has a unique dual mode of action as a noradrenergic and specific serotonergic antidepressant
A single 15 mg dose of mirtazapine to healthy volunteers has been found to result in over 80% occupancy of the H 1 receptor and to induce intense sleepiness

The recommended starting dose of mirtazapine tablets is 15 mg once daily, administered orally, preferably in the evening prior to sleep

If you and your doctor decide to take you off mirtazapine, your doctor will probably recommend reducing your dose gradually to help prevent extra side effects
This is to help prevent you getting any withdrawal symptoms as you come off the medicine

At low doses below those needed for antidepressant efficacy, mirtazapine binds more avidly to the histamine site than to the adrenergic sites, leading to increased daytime sedation

In the controlled clinical trials establishing the efficacy of mirtazapine in the treatment of major depressive disorder, the effective dose range was generally 15 to 45 mg/day
